About the team:

The Advanced Analytics and Risk Modelling team is working together with Risk teams across the Nordics ensuring that the model developments and related controls are following the highest of standards and implemented and monitored for all the products in each country under the same governance. The team is responsible for the following areas:

  • Development of regulatory parameter models for calculation of capital (IRB PD LGD EAD)

  • Development of scoring and rating models for underwriting customer behaviour and other purposes (e.g. Fraud Collections etc.)

  • Development of parameter models used for the calculation of expected credit losses (PD LGD EAD)

  • Development of Stress Test Models

  • Model management planning and governance

  • Artificial Intelligence Machine Learning and related innovation initiatives with key focus on the area of credit risk
